Before house-hunting ever starts, it is excellent to understand simply how much house the customer can afford. By preparing ahead, time will be conserved in the long run and obtaining loans that may be rejected and bidding on residential or commercial properties that can not be gotten are prevented. Know what banks are the best ones to determine private eligibility is extremely useful info needed before even searching for a home.
techyon.co.nz
The old formula that was utilized to identify how much a borrower might manage was about three times the gross yearly income. However, this formula has shown to not always be trustworthy. It is more secure and more reasonable to look at the private budget plan and figure out just how much cash there is to spare and what the month-to-month payments on a brand-new house will be. When finding out what type of mortgage payment one can manage, other elements such as taxes upkeep, insurance, and other expenditures should be factored. Usually, loan providers do not want borrowers having monthly payments surpassing more than 28% to 44% of the debtor's regular monthly earnings. For those who have outstanding credit, the lending institution might allow the payments to surpass 44%. Check Your Credit Rating Thoroughly

Lenders like to take a look at credit rating through a request to credit bureaus to make the debtor's credit file offered. This permits the loan provider to make a more educated choice regarding loan prequalification. Through the credit report, lenders get the borrower's credit rating, likewise called the FICO rating and this information can be acquired from the significant credit bureaus TransUnion, Experiean, and Equifax. The FICO rating represents the statistical summary of data consisted of within the credit report. It consists of bill payment history and the number of arrearages in contrast to the customer's income.

The greater the debtor's credit report, the simpler it is to get a loan or to pre-qualify for a mortgage. If the borrower routinely pays expenses late, then a lower credit report is expected. A lower score may convince the lender to decline the application, require a large down payment, or examine a high interest rate in order to decrease the danger they are taking on the borrower.

Mortgage Loan Preapproval and Loan Prequalification

After basic computations have been done and a financial declaration has actually been finished, the borrower can ask the lending institution for a prequalification letter. What the prequalification letter states is that loan approval is likely based on credit history and earnings. Prequalifying lets the borrower know precisely just how much can be obtained and how much will be needed for a down payment.

However, prequalification might not suffice in some situations. The debtor desires to be preapproved because it implies that a particular loan amount is guaranteed. It is more binding and it implies the lending institution has actually currently carried out a credit check and evaluated the financial scenario, rather than depend on the customers own declarations like what is carried out in prequalification. Preapproval means the lending institution will in fact lend the money after an appraisal of the residential or commercial property and a purchase agreement and title report has actually been prepared.

How Lenders Determine Just How Much Mortgage You Receive

There are 2 simple ratios that loan providers use to determine just how much to pre-approve a borrower for. Here's how these ratios are computed:

Front-end Debt to Income Ratio

Ratio # 1: Total month-to-month housing costs compared to total monthly income

- The debtor ought to jot down, before deductions, the total gross quantity of income received per month.

  • The number in step 1 ought to be multiplied by.28. This is what most lenders will utilize as a guide to what the overall housing costs are for the customer. Depending on the percentage, a greater portion may be used.
  • This front end ratio consists of major expenditures tied to homeownership consisting of the core loan payment, PMI, house owner's insurance in addition to residential or commercial property taxes. HOA charges would likewise be consisted of in this overall.

    Back-end Debt to Income Ratio

    Ratio # 2: total financial obligation and housing costs to income

    - The borrower jots down all monthly payments that extend beyond 11 months into the future. These can be installment loans, car loans, credit card payments, etc- These monthly financial obligation commitments are then contributed to the regular monthly housing-related expenses.
  • The resulting number in the first step must be increased by.36. Total monthly debt service commitments plus housing expenses need to not surpass the resulting number.

    Credit and Mortgage Loan Qualification

    When certifying for a mortgage, credit plays a very crucial function. Here are concerns a lending institution will more than likely ask:

    - Is the credit history of the customer thought about to be good?
  • Does the customer have a recent personal bankruptcy, late payments, or collections? If so, is there a description?
  • Are there extreme month-to-month payments?
  • Are credit cards maxed out?

    The responses to these concerns can make a decision as far as the eligibility of a mortgage loan goes.

    Collateral and Mortgage Loan Qualification

    If the loan would go beyond the amount the residential or commercial property deserves, the lender will not lend the money. If the appraisal reveals the residential or commercial property is worth less than the offer, the terms can often be worked out with the seller and the property agent representing the seller.

    Sometimes a customer may even pay the distinction between the loan and the sales rate if they agree to purchase the home at the rate that was originally provided to them. To do such a thing, the debtor requires to have non reusable money and should ask the concern of whether the residential or commercial property is likely to hold its value. The borrower needs to likewise think about the kind of loan they receive. If the borrower would need to move unexpectedly and the loan is bigger than the worth of the residential or commercial property, the loan can be a really hard thing to settle.
